GMAT Exam Drill is ideal for students who would like to complete their GMAT preparation in a very short period of time as well as for our Kaplan GMAT alumni to review and apply their skills in a fresh and challenging environment. This course covers all of the concepts and skills necessary for success on both the Quantitative and Verbal sections of the GMAT. Students will be provided with practical, effective strategies applied to real GMAT questions by an experienced trainer.
